  3. The Visible Light Spectrum Is part of the electromagnetic spectrum that can be detected by the human eye. In wavelength, this is defined as 380 to 780 nm by the ISO 13666 which is the Ophthalmic optics standards published by the International Standards Organization. There are slightly different definitions depending upon the source. (390 to 760nm) The pure colours of the spectrum are defined by the wavelength. Of course, not all species of animals have the same visible spectrum (Bees – for example – can apparently see ultraviolet wavelengths and snakes can “see” infrared light. Even among humans, there is also some variability. UV Light (for reference). UVC - 100 – 280 UVB - 280 – 315 UVA – 315-400

  9. The Dark Side of Blue Light It is a well known phenomena that Melatonin, a hormone released in brain, plays a key role in our natural circadian (sleep – wake) cycle. Blue light in this third area of wavelength, is a powerful suppressor of melatonin. In man’s natural evolution, the light of day keeps melatonin suppressed and when the sun sets and darkness descends upon us, melatonin is released – which induces our natural sleep patterns. In today’s unnaturally light world after dark, which is further bombarded by all sorts of electronic devices that emit blue light, melatonin is further suppressed, which serves to delay the onset of our natural sleep time. There is a large body of emerging evidence to suggest that melatonin suppression by HEVL may be a causal contributor to chronic diseases, including diabetes, cancer and obesity. ================================ The study, titled "Limiting the impact of light pollution on human health, environment and stellar visibility" by Fabio Falchi, Pierantonio Cinzano, Christopher D. Elvidge, David M. Keith and Abraham Haim, was recently published in the Journal of Environmental Management. The fact that "white" artificial light (which is actually blue light on the spectrum, emitted at wavelengths of between 440-500 nanometers) suppresses the production of melatonin in the brain's pineal gland is already known. Also known is the fact that suppressing the production of melatonin, which is responsible, among other things, for the regulation of our biological clock, causes behavior disruptions and health problems. In this study, conducted by astronomers, physicists and biologists from ISTIL- Light Pollution Science and Technology Institute in Italy, the National Geophysical Data Center in Boulder, Colorado, and the University of Haifa, researchers for the first time examined the differences in melatonin suppression in a various types of light bulbs, primarily those used for outdoor illumination, such as streetlights, road lighting, mall lighting and the like.   16. AMD is Age related macular degeneration. The macula is the central area of the retina, which provides the most detailed central vision. AMD is basically reducing the vision and can even lead to blindness. Some researchers found that visible blue light can increase the risk of AMD FOR damage to occur the light must be absorbed -- In order for a photochemical reaction to occur, the light must be absorbed and the human eye has unique filtering characteristics that determine in which area of the eye each wavelength of light will be absorbed. This is a natural protection. UV radiation below 295 nm is filtered from reaching the lens by the human cornea. This means that the shortest, most energetic wavelengths of light (all UV-C and some UV-B) are filtered out before they reach the human lens. The remaining UV light is absorbed by the crystalline lens, but the exact wavelength range depends upon age.
  17. The cornea generally blocks UVC (100-280nm) and UVB (280-315NM) light from reaching the human lens. A healthy young lens filters out UVA and shorter wavelengths (HEVL) of blue light from reaching the cornea. (UVA 315-400nm) - note sometimes UVA is defined as 315 - 390 As we age (about 40 years) , the photobiology of the human lens changes. In a young adult protective compounds (Chromophores) harmlessly absorb UV light. As we reach middle age, these chromophores change their character and start to release the energy they absorb through harmful oxygen particles (Free radicals) which cause yellowing of the lens and ultimately opacification of the lens (i.e. Cataract). The proteins within the lens become compromised. When the lens function is compromised more harmful light can reach the retina.

  19. Beaver Dam Eye Study is a long term eye study conducted in Beaver Dam Wisconsin. The Beaver Dam Eye Study is funded by the National Eye Institute. The purpose of the Study is to collect information on the prevalence and incidence of age-related cataract, macular degeneration and diabetic retinopathy, which are all common eye diseases causing loss of vision in an aging population. The study was designed to discover (or detect) causes of these conditions. The study also has examined other aging problems, such as decline in overall health and quality of life and development of kidney and heart disease. The Beaver Dam Eye Study completed its 20-year follow-up at the end of 2010. The purposes of the follow-up were to observe the long-term course of cataract, macular degeneration, diabetic retinopathy, other retinal diseases, and to monitor the decline in vision as the Eye Study participants age. We examined the relationship of long-term exposures (e.g., blood pressure, lipid levels, exposure to UV-light, and medications) to these eye conditions.

  27. AMD Risk Factors – American Academy of Ophthalmology. Although researchers do not have a definitive picture of what causes AMD, aging processes are clearly important. A number of additional factors that may put a person at greater risk for developing AMD have been identified.   Age – By definition, age is the greatest risk factor for AMD. An estimated, 1.75 million Americans age 40 years and older have advanced dry or wet AMD. The prevalence increases dramatically with age, with more than 15 percent of Caucasian women 80 years and older having advanced AMD.34 To ensure early detection of all age-related eye conditions, people over the age of 40 are encouraged to see an ophthalmologist for comprehensive eye exams every two to four years.   Genetics - New evidence exists that some cases of AMD are hereditary. Recent reports have shown that as many as 43% of patients with AMD have a genetic mutation in the Complement factor H gene.17-19   Complement Factor H is involved in the control of inflammation in the body and those patients with this genetic trait may be at higher risk from inflammatory induced damage to the retinal pigment epithelium. AMD may be a group of diseases that require different approaches to treatment. For that reason, because early stages of the disease are often asymptomatic and because both wet and dry AMD can progress, everyone over the age of 50, even those without a family history of the disease, should have their eyes checked regularly.   Environmental and Behavioral Risk Factors   Several factors have been identified as having a possible relationship to AMD. Cigarette smoking – Studies have found that current and former smokers had as much as twice the risk of developing AMD as non-smokers.  Although long-term advantages of smoking cessation are not yet known, people with AMD may be well advised to stop smoking. Exposure to secondhand smoke also contributes to the risk of developing AMD.   High blood pressure – Severe AMD has been associated with moderate to severe elevations in blood pressure, according to a recent epidemiological study, which found that patients with wet (exudative or neovascular) AMD, the more severe form, were more than four times as likely to have moderate or severe hypertension than patients without AMD. Additionally, cardiovascular disease, in general, appears to be associated with increased risk of AMD.   Overexposure in sunlight – It has been suggested that exposure to sunlight might damage the macula and cause AMD. Studies to support this theory have been inconclusive thus far and additional studies are under way. Nonetheless, ophthalmologists recommend protecting eyes from the sun and other UV light for a variety of benefits.   Diet – Research on the link between diet and AMD risk has shown that intake of a variety of food types may alter the risk of developing AMD. For example, high consumption of linoleic acid, monounsaturated, polyunsaturated and vegetable fats – fats commonly found in many snack foods – was associated with double the risk of developing wet AMD. Researchers also found that people with limited intake of linoleic acid and who ate two or more servings of fish that is high in Omega 3 fatty acids per week had a lower risk for developing AMD. Other studies have shown that intake of fruits may reduce the risk of AMD, as would diets rich in carotenoids, such as lutein and zeaxanthin, found in dark green leafy vegetables and some berries. These data are not conclusive, however, and may not translate into recommendations.   Estrogen and early menopause – Studies suggest a higher incidence of AMD in women, particularly in women who experience earlier onset of menopause, which suggests that estrogen may play a protective role in minimizing AMD risk.   Other Possible Risk Factors In addition to the above risk factors, researchers are looking at hyperopia (farsightedness), light skin and eye coloring, cataract surgery, high blood cholesterol levels and race as possible factors that increase the risk of developing AMD.
